The Sky man told me that we could just fit a new cable (standard tv cable from Focus etc) up to one of the bedrooms and the old box could then be used as a Freesat box with no extra charges/no card needed.
He should have told you that you will need Satellite Cable, not standard TV Cable which is just co-ax.
Satellite Cable is screened.0 -
